Installation Guide

Tools Needed:

  • Adjustable wrench
  • Level
  • Screwdrivers (flat and Phillips)
  • Pliers
  • Tape measure
  • Pipe thread seal tape

Step-by-Step Installation

  1. Choose Installation Location: Select a location near necessary plumbing and electrical connections on a solid, level floor under a countertop.
  2. Remove Shipping Materials: Remove all shipping bolts and packaging materials from the dishwasher interior and exterior.
  3. Connect Water Supply: Connect hot water supply line to the water inlet valve. Use only new hoses and apply pipe thread seal tape.
  4. Connect Drain Hose: Route the drain hose into a standpipe or garbage disposal with a high loop to prevent backflow.
  5. Electrical Connection: Connect to a properly grounded 120V, 60Hz, AC only dedicated outlet. Do not use an extension cord.
  6. Level the Dishwasher: Adjust the leveling legs to ensure the dishwasher is level from front to back and side to side.
  7. Test Run: Run the dishwasher through a complete cycle to check for leaks and proper operation.
Warning: All installations must be performed by a qualified installer to ensure proper operation and maintain warranty coverage.

Specifications

Model Series DW80R506UG
Type Built-in Dishwasher
Color Stainless Steel / Black
Place Settings 14 Place Settings
Noise Level 39 dBA
Control Type Hidden Touch Controls with LED Display
Energy Rating ENERGY STAR® Certified
Water Consumption 2.9 gallons per cycle
Power Requirements 120V, 60Hz, 15A
Dimensions (HxWxD) 34.5 x 23.8 x 24.5 inches
Weight 75 lbs
Drying System Heat Dry with Fan Assist

Key Features

StormWash™ Technology

Samsung's innovative StormWash™ technology uses powerful spray jets to blast away tough, baked-on food particles with 40x more powerful cleaning action.

WaterWall™ Technology

The advanced WaterWall™ technology creates a powerful wave of water that moves up and down the dishwasher to provide complete coverage and superior cleaning.

Zone Booster™

Focus extra cleaning power on specific areas of the dishwasher for heavily soiled pots, pans, and dishes in the lower rack.

Third Rack

Extra third rack provides additional space for utensils, small items, and cooking tools, maximizing loading capacity and organization.

Smart Control

Wi-Fi enabled for remote control via smartphone app, allowing you to monitor cycle status, download additional programs, and receive completion alerts.

Auto Release Door

Automatically opens at the end of the cycle to release steam and improve drying performance through natural air circulation.

Wash Cycle Options

Heavy

Intensive cleaning for heavily soiled pots, pans, and dishes

Normal

Standard cleaning for everyday dishes with normal soil

Light

Quick wash for lightly soiled dishes and glassware

Rinse Only

Quick rinse to prevent food from drying on dishes

Sanitize

High-temperature wash to eliminate 99.9% of bacteria

Delay Start

Set the dishwasher to run at a later time for convenience

Troubleshooting

Problem Possible Cause Solution
Dishwasher won't start Power issue, door not closed properly Check power supply, ensure door is latched completely
Poor cleaning results Overloading, wrong detergent, incorrect program Reduce load size, use correct detergent, select appropriate program
Water not draining Drain hose clogged or kinked Check drain hose for obstructions or kinks, clean filter
Leaking water Door not sealed, overfilling, loose connections Check door seal, ensure proper detergent amount, check connections
Unusual noises Foreign objects in spray arms, unbalanced load Check for foreign objects, redistribute dishes evenly
Dishes not drying Rinse aid empty, heating element issue Refill rinse aid, check heating element function

Error Codes

  • 4C: Water supply issue - Check water supply and inlet valve
  • 5C: Drain issue - Check drain hose and pump
  • LC: Leak detected - Check for leaks and water supply
  • OC: Motor issue - Contact service center
  • dC: Door not closed properly - Ensure door is fully closed
  • 9C: Heating issue - Check heating element and thermostat
